About A. Zhakhov

A. Zhakhov is a scholar working on Microbiology, Neurology and Immunology, having authored 15 papers that have together received 326 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Heat shock proteins research (6 papers), Complement system in diseases (3 papers) and Protein Structure and Dynamics (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Immunology (137 citations), Neurology (35 citations) and Biomaterials (49 citations). A. Zhakhov has collaborated with scholars based in Russia, United States and Germany. Frequent co-authors include A. Ischenko, Marc Fontaine, Maxim Shevtsov, Emil Pitkin, А. В. Добродумов, B. P. Nikolaev, Sergey Orlov, Boris A. Margulis, Nikolay Aksenov and Denis A. Mogilenko.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ología and Scientific Reports.
